Questions about 535i
I've been searching for bmw e34, and I was focusing on 540i, then now I am kind of interested in 535i/5.
The only reason I didn't even care about 535i was no passenger side air bag...too bad. My wife will sit on passenger side and the air bag must have......but anyway.... I did search here about 535i, but I couldn't get all the answers. Does 535i has the same problem as 540i? I know it doesn't have nikasil problem, but how about head gasket or other major problems on engine or transmission? It seems like 540i is better car than 535i, but I would like to know more about this car. What to check before buy, and what are the major known issues. Thank you. |

I've not had my 535/5 very long. But I am not aware of any specific problems with the driveline. The engine is known to last 400k miles between rebuilds if taken care of. Trans is likewise pretty strong. M30s are very stout engines.
Now, as for deferred maintenance, you want to pay close attention, but that would be similar with a 540. My car needs a bunch of work (mostly suspension) but I only paid $900 for it and it only has 129k miles, so I'm not complaining too loudly. Suspension work is generally a 100k mile deal, and on my car it obviously wasn't done at that time lol. So I'm doing it now.

the 535i has no engine block issues but the head might require work on very high mileage engines. the head gaskets are sensitive to over-heating. not that they are a regular failing part, but they don't hold up to a poor maintained cooling system. and let me tell you that it is dirt cheap to overhaul the cooling system of the 535i (i just ordered the parts). the auto in the 535i is stronger than the one in the 540i but won't last as long as the engine. the 5spd getrag 260s are almost bulletproof. If i were looking for an e34 today it would be between a 535i/5 and a 540i/6 and i would probably buy whichever one is in better shape. wow, I just checked this out and you are right.
